AI GPTs for Ontological Discourse are advanced computational tools designed to engage with and generate content related to ontology, the philosophical study of being, existence, and reality. Leveraging the power of Generative Pre-trained Transformers, these AI models offer nuanced and context-aware outputs, making them invaluable for tasks requiring deep understanding and generation of ontological concepts. By integrating cutting-edge AI, these tools facilitate a wide range of applications, from academic research to practical problem-solving in fields where understanding the nature of being and entities is crucial.
